MM#009 Default HESSI Target

Dear RHESSI Collaborators,

Solar flare activity is very low. The target region is now located on the west limb. Minor B-class activity is possible today.

The position of NOAA 1140 on January 12 at 16:00 UT is: N33W83 (Solar X = 811", Solar Y = 537")
